    @starry4471 ปีที่แล้ว +1

    For clarification, the long elements at the bottom of the boosters are not fins, those are in fact landing legs. Falcon Heavy's 2 side boosters detach before performing retro-propulsive landings so they can be fully reused. They actually land a couple hundred feet from each other, pretty much simultaneously.
